Seared Salmon with Garlic Green Beans and Brown Rice

Enjoy a perfectly seared salmon fillet paired with garlicky sautéed green beans and a side of warm, nutty brown rice. This dish harmonizes a crisp texture with rich flavors to fuel your evening meal with balanced nutrition.

NUTRITION

511kcal
Protein
43.8g
Fat
21.2g
Carbs
35.8g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7 oz Salmon Fillet

1/2 cup cooked Brown Rice

1 cup Green Beans

1 clove Garlic, minced

1/2 teaspoon Olive Oil

1 Lemon Wedge

Salt &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Pat the salmon dry and season both sides with salt and pepper.

  • 2

    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, sear the salmon skin-side down (if applicable) for about 3-4 minutes until a crust forms, then flip and cook for another 3-4 minutes until done to your liking.

  • 3

    While the salmon is cooking, bring a pot of water to a simmer and blanch the green beans for about 2-3 minutes until crisp-tender. Drain and set aside.

  • 4

    In a small pan, heat 1/2 teaspoon of olive oil over medium heat, add the minced garlic, and quickly sauté for about 30 seconds to 1 minute until fragrant. Toss the blanched green beans in the garlic-infused oil.

  • 5

    Warm the pre-cooked brown rice if needed or serve it at room temperature as a hearty base.

  • 6

    Plate the brown rice, top with the seared salmon, and arrange the garlic green beans on the side. Garnish with a lemon wedge and a squeeze of fresh lemon juice over the salmon before serving.
